    CNN PRODUCER NOTE     Quasistellar recently moved from a house to an apartment in Sandy Springs, Georgia, and she feared her new living space wouldn't allow enough room for a home garden. However, she found that no matter the size of one's home, there is always enough space to grow some veggies. Quasistellar documents the growth of cherry tomatoes she and her daughter planted in April.
    - stein0726, CNN iReport producer

    Take a look at the cherry tomatoes in my garden.  As you can see my space for planting is very limited but we do just fine provided there is fertile soil, ample sunshine, plenty of rain, and very few critters.

     

    This is my first container garden and these tomatoes are the first harvest of the season!  I have already planted orka, (micro greens) spicy mixed lettuce, rainbow quinoa, and mustard greens as well.

     

    Early on, our garden encountered some unexpected wormy green visitors whom consumed an entire pot of quinoa!  I don't like to use any pesticides so I should have seen that one coming.  Oh well...

     

    I am excited about this new way of gardening.  I will plant some more seeds today and then get ramped up to speed on how to keep the wormy green predators at bay in an environmentally save way. Wish me luck!
